Haryana D.El.Ed September 2025 Exam Admit Cards Released at bseh.org.in

The Board of School Education Haryana (BSEH), Bhiwani, has officially released the Haryana D.El.Ed September 2025 exam admit cards today - 16 September, 2025 at bseh.org.in. Students enrolled in the Diploma in Elementary Education (D.El.Ed) course can now download their admit cards by entering their registration number and date of birth on the official portal.

The Haryana Board has announced that the secondary and senior secondary examinations will be conducted from September 25 to October 18, 2025, in the afternoon session between 2 pm and 5 pm. This year, a total of 44,575 candidates have registered for the exams, which includes 28,523 male and 16,052 female students.

Out of the total, 5,542 candidates will appear for the secondary (regular) exam, while 4,338 candidates are enrolled in the senior secondary regular exam. Additionally, 14,954 candidates have registered for the open school secondary level, and 19,741 students will take the open school senior secondary exam.

Meanwhile, the D.El.Ed first- and second-year examinations are also scheduled between September 25 and October 21, 2025, in the afternoon session. For this teacher training examination, around 23,569 student-teachers are set to appear, including 15,480 women and 8,089 men.

The Haryana D.El.Ed examination is crucial for candidates aspiring to build their careers in teaching at the elementary level. The admit card includes essential details such as the candidate's name, roll number, exam date, subject-wise schedule, reporting time, and the exam centre address.

Candidates are strongly advised to check all the details printed on the admit card carefully. In case of any discrepancy, they must immediately contact the board authorities for correction. Along with the admit card, students must also carry one valid photo ID proof such as an Aadhaar Card, Voter ID, Driving License, or PAN Card to the exam centre.

The board has issued certain important instructions for the candidates appearing in the exam. Students must report to the examination centre at least 30 minutes before the exam begins. Electronic gadgets, calculators, smartwatches, and mobile phones are strictly prohibited inside the exam hall. Following the guidelines strictly is essential to avoid cancellation of candidature.
